Best-websites-a-programmer-should-visit:程序员必备的优秀网站集合
在程序设计的世界里,掌握最新技术、学习新知识是每个程序员必备的能力。那么,有哪些网站是程序员们应当访问,以保持对技术的敏锐度和学习能力呢?本文将向您推荐一个开源项目,它整理了众多对程序员有用的网站资源,助您在编程路上更进一步。
项目介绍
"Best-websites-a-programmer-should-visit" 是一个开源项目,其宗旨是收集并分享那些对程序员有用的网站。无论您是编程初学者还是经验丰富的开发者,这些网站都能提供丰富的学习资源、技术动态和编程挑战,帮助您提升技能,拓宽知识面。
项目技术分析
本项目采用简单的列表形式,将网站资源按照功能进行了分类,包括解决编程问题、获取最新技术新闻、编程实践、项目灵感、编码建议以及面试准备等。这样的分类使得程序员可以根据自己的需求和兴趣快速找到相应的资源。
每个分类下都列出了多个相关的网站,并提供简要描述,让用户对网站内容有一个基本的了解。此外,项目还不断更新,以保证资源的时效性和准确性。
项目技术应用场景
无论是您在编程学习中遇到难题需要解决,还是希望了解最新的技术动态,抑或是想要寻找一些编程挑战来锻炼自己的技能,这个项目都能提供相应的网站资源。以下是几个具体的应用场景:
-
编程问题解决: 当您在编程中遇到难题时,可以访问 Stack Overflow 或 Quora,这两个网站聚集了大量经验丰富的程序员,您可以在这里找到问题的答案或与其他程序员讨论。
-
技术新闻获取: 通过 Hacker News、Ars Technica 等新闻聚合网站,您可以及时了解到业界最新的技术动态和趋势。
-
编程实践与挑战: Reddit.com/r/dailyprogrammer、CodeAbbey 等网站提供了丰富的编程挑战和练习,适合各个层次的程序员进行实践。
-
面试准备: 如果您正在准备技术面试,可以访问 GeeksforGeeks、LeetCode 等网站,它们提供了大量的面试题和解决方案,有助于您在面试中脱颖而出。
项目特点
-
全面性: 项目涵盖了从编程学习到面试准备的各种资源,适合不同层次的程序员。
-
分类明确: 网站按照功能进行了明确的分类,方便用户快速定位所需资源。
-
持续更新: 项目保持更新,不断添加新的有用网站,确保资源的时效性。
总结来说,"Best-websites-a-programmer-should-visit" 是一个对程序员非常有价值的开源项目。通过这个项目,您可以发现众多优秀的编程资源,无论是学习新技术、解决编程问题,还是为面试做准备,都能在这里找到合适的网站。让我们一起利用这些资源,不断提升自己的编程技能吧!
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考